Output bb85964020e718acf4f13fb2686e17fc0357f75a08d64bc40192835241a7d9f3:1

value
358853732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a18335289d8b30b109a4d0cdbbc0602881e4e8 OP_EQUAL
address
ML5jb2kMjxCCucfE5sP2o3kQHSuGnvqbU6
transaction
bb85964020e718acf4f13fb2686e17fc0357f75a08d64bc40192835241a7d9f3
spent
true